Carols by Candlelight was created in 1990 by Steve Vaus and Wayne Nelson, with the goal of making a life-changing difference in the lives of children. Originally a free concert at Horton Plaza, the event eventually outgrew that location, moving to the Poway Center for the Performing Arts and ultimately to it's current home, the California Center for the Arts, Escondido.

Artists such as Billy Ray Cyrus, Kenny Loggins, Lee Anne Womack, America, Sara Evans, Steve Wariner, Little River Band, the Commodores, Joe Diffie, Stephen Bishop, Kim Carnes and many more have entertained Carols audiences over the years, and  helped raise much-needed funds for San Diego charities that serve children.
